How to Choose a Fence

When it comes to installing a privacy fence, one of the most important decisions you'll need to make is what type of material to use. There are a variety of options to choose from, each with their own set of benefits and drawbacks. Here's a look at some of the most popular materials used for privacy fences:

• Wood: Wood is a classic choice for privacy fences, and for good reason. It's readily available, easy to work with, and can be stained or painted to match the look of your property. However, wood fences do require regular maintenance to keep them in good condition.

• Vinyl: Vinyl is a low-maintenance option that's becoming increasingly popular for privacy fences. It's resistant to rot, insects, and weather, and it doesn't need to be painted or stained. Plus, the modern vinyl fencing comes in a variety of designs, colors and patterns. However, it's generally more expensive than wood.

• Aluminum: Aluminum fences are lightweight, durable and also a low-maintenance option. They offer the same benefits as vinyl fencing, but also won't rust or deteriorate and are also more affordable compared to other options.

• Chain link: Chain link fences offer great strength and durability for security purpose, it is often used for industrial and commercial properties. This option is not as common for residential, but with the addition of privacy slats it can provide privacy as well.

• Iron: Iron is an option that is mostly use for more decorative and classic looking fences, it offers great durability and security, and it requires less maintenance than wood, but it is not rust-proof.

Ultimately, the right material for your privacy fence will depend on your budget, the look you're trying to achieve, and the amount of maintenance you're willing to do.
